1. RiverhouseAddress: 3075 N. Business 97, Bend, OR 97703
Phone Number : +1 541-389-3111
Facility: This 4-star hotel sits right along the beautiful Deschutes River and offers guests a serene, nature-inspired setting. Riverhouse on the Deschutes features luxurious rooms with river views, an outdoor pool, indoor pool, hot tub, and a full-service spa. The hotel’s restaurant, Currents, serves fresh, locally-sourced dishes in a stylish riverside setting.
Price: Rates typically range from $200 to $350 per night, depending on the season and room type.

FAQ
Q: What is the best time to visit Bend?
A: Bend is great year-round, but summer and winter are peak seasons. Visit in the summer for hiking, kayaking, and biking. Winter is ideal for skiing and snowboarding.
Q: How do I choose between a 3-star and 5-star hotel?
A: If luxury and amenities are important, opt for a 4- or 5-star hotel. However, if you're seeking comfort and affordability, a 3-star hotel like DoubleTree or SpringHill Suites may be more appropriate.
Q: Are there hotels close to outdoor activities?
A: Yes! Hotels like Tetherow and Pronghorn Resort are per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Both offer easy access to golf, hiking, skiing, and more.

2. Oxford Hotel
Address: 10 NW Minnesota Ave, Bend, OR 97703
Phone Number : +1 541-382-8436
Facility: The Oxford Hotel is a chic 4-star boutique hotel located in the heart of downtown Bend. Guests enjoy eco-friendly amenities, a state-of-the-art fitness center, and an on-site restaurant that focuses on organic and sustainable ingredients. Rooms are modern, with high-end furnishings and eco-friendly toiletries.
Price: Expect to pay between $300 and $450 per night for a luxury experience in the heart of downtown.
